It's not the water that leaches, but the chemicals in the plastic leach into the water. It means that the plastic will break down a little and release some of its components into your drinking water, especially if you use it more than once.
The typical soda / juice / water bottle is made from polythylene terephthalate (PET or PETE, plastic number 1).

In this case PCO stands for Plastic Closure Only. This is a name for a particular thread used for plastic bottles and caps. 28 stands for the 28mm diameter of the thread.

If you mean plastic bottles... it depends on where they're recycled and exactly what they're made of. A variety of factors make many plastics difficult to truly recycle, so instead they are sometimes converted into other products (for example, they might be made into, say, parking blocks) or in some cases they simply wind up in the landfill with all the other trash. Nearly all plastic bottles are made entirely of virgin resin for health and safety reasons, not from recycled material.
